Rio Grande is a mountain in Argentina with an elevation of 5083 metres. Rio Grande is within the following mountain ranges: Argentine Andes, Puna de Atacama, Andean Volcaninc Belt (Central Part). It is located at the Argentinean province of Catamarca. Its slopes are at the Argentinean city of Antofagasta de la Sierra.
Based on the elevation provided by the available Digital elevation models, SRTM filled with ASTER (5083m), TanDEM-X(5124m), , Rio Grande is about 5083 meters above sea level.The height of the nearest key col is 4632 meters so its prominence is 451 meters. Rio Grande is listed as mountain, based on the Dominance system and its dominance is 8,87%.
